You were in the right. You are a customer patronizing their business with the reasonable expectation that the money and time you spend in that effort will result in some sort of value trade off. It is not your responsibility to spend more time and frustration “searching” for an employee so that you could pay for an expected that value you did not receive. If you were still waiting for your entree that was ordered over an hour ago and they did not give you any kind of attention regarding the slow service (like a manager coming by several times to apologize and offering you another bottle of wine, etc.) than you shouldn’t feel bad at all. If nobody in that restaurant cared enough to figure out wtf was going on on your behalf, you shouldn’t care about them absorbing $10 in real food/beverage cost that eventually sucked up an hour of your time and made you frustrated for an hour.

I had a similar thing happen to me a few years back in Asheville NC. My wife and I sat for two hours waiting on entrees. It took only 5 minutes to get sweet teas but the app took 30 minutes. We ordered entrees when she brought the app and we waited for 2 hours before we left. But in my case, the waitress and the manager were apologizing and actually told us that 3 cooks had quit at the same time. I finally told him we couldn’t wait any longer and he said he understood. I paid him for the drinks and the appetizer just because of the attention he was giving us and the fact he showed he cared. I think I drank a gallon of sweet tea though. LOL. She was on the sweet tea fill ups.

But if what you described is accurate and they just had a “nobody gives a frick” attitude than you have nothing to feel bad about.
